Piere check out the following image.
Make those selections in preferences before you make the entry.
use TRADE THROUGH for long positions
use FIRST TOUCH for short positions
Plus if you want the platform to work for pest price move the slider to the left. If you move it to the right then the platform will execute the order faster.
